Oil workers in Wassit conduct open sit-in
2/24/2013 3:06 PM

WASSIT/ Aswat al-Iraq: Ahdab Oilfield workers conducted here an open sit-in to demand an increase in their wages and better work conditions.

The sit-in resulted in stopping the work in the field, while the Chinese Waha company declined to comment.

The workers suffered many problems including the low wages in comparison to work hours, which, sometimes, reach to 12 hours per day, in addition to mal-treatment by the Chinese company, as well as the bad food, according to one of the participants in the sit-in.

The workers, also, demanded the return of the fired workers and to appoint them within the cadres of Iraqi ministry of oil.

Aswat al-Iraq tried to contact the Chinese company, but the officials rejected to comment.

Kut, center of the province, lies 180 km south east of the capital, Baghdad.
